Transaction e64384364a12476820840ba8b5cc99a0fa0cf03409da5cc35cb691da1ba67510
1 Input
1 Output
-
e64384364a12476820840ba8b5cc99a0fa0cf03409da5cc35cb691da1ba67510:0
- value
- 172869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f08e958b4e3c6df456a56d63c9b543f9104a9a3 OP_EQUAL
- address
- 35yiMk1V4XAGrXQA6WEd7CTHVrfXwQm9GS